Mercury 90-150 Hp Crossflow Power Head Rebuild Kit STD SIZE 2.875" 100-15-30WSM Outboard Mercury 90 150 Hp Crossflow Power Head Rebuild Kit (picture is generic) STD SIZE ONLY 2. 875" This kit meets or exceeds OEM specifications Kit includes everything you need to re build your outboard engine. Piston OE # 7437A3, 774 8600A3, 774 9137A9, 8199A3, 8200A4 Includes: Six Brand New High Quality WSM Pistons, rings, pins and clips, complete gasket kit, upper lower and center main crank bearings, rod bearings and rod bolts ITEM#: 100
